The grounds for recognition of financial claims made following a foreign divorce are the same as the grounds mentioned in question 1. If the parties reach an agreement for divorce in the mediation procedure, the parties are granted a divorce by mediation, but if not, the parties cannot get divorced by mediation. Under Japanese law, there is no concept of joint parental authority, and there is no presumption of an equal division of time between separating or divorcing parents. A district court states that the opinion of the child taken by a Japanese mother from a foreign father is not always trustworthy in that the child is heavily dependent on the mother and may be influenced by her opinion too much.

Japanese Word For Mother In Law

This sole parental rights holder and sole custodian system is not a global standard, having been criticised by the US and EU where a joint parental rights holder and joint custodian system is implemented. Upon the determination of the sole parental authority, the court would consider: who is the primary caregiver of the children; how to maintain the continuity of the children's family and school life; and the children's own will.
